The fundamental question is, why should some organization which was granted address space and has been using it for years be forced to give it back and deploy NAT? Keep in mind that NAT is expensive, not just in terms of equipment but in design and installation costs, and the tech support needed for all the things that don't work behind NAT. And we're doing this just to delay the migration to IPv6 a little bit longer -- we're still going to have to do it, and soon. Meanwhile, freeing small blocks of address space here and there doesn't really help the big picture, but does grow the size of the global routing table significantly. Apples and oranges. The closer you get to the default free zone, the less operators care about individual nodes or small nets; it's all about getting packets to the next large operator. There's no state kept for each routing decision. You need RAM for the routing table and that's it; routing is done in ASICs. Turning on NAT isn't just a matter of flipping a switch; it would require tons more RAM and processing power. > I don’t *know* what devices they are > using so I can’t name them, but they are obviously using something capable.
